Utah LLC vs. Corporation: Picking the Proper Structure for Your Startup
Choosing the right business construction shapes how your Utah startup operates, pays taxes, protects its owners, and attracts investment. Many entrepreneurs slender the decision down to 2 options: forming a Utah Limited Liability Firm (LLC) or making a Utah corporation. Both entities offer liability protection, yet they perform differently in ownership, taxation, flexibility, and compliance. Understanding these differences helps you make a smart, strategic alternative that helps long-term growth.
Utah LLC: Flexible, Simple, and Founder-Friendly
A Utah LLC is a popular alternative for small businesses, freelancers, family-run operations, and early-stage startups that value simplicity. One among its defining strengths is versatile management. Owners, called "members," can run the business directly or appoint managers, giving founders more freedom to structure choice-making as they prefer.
An LLC additionally stands out for pass-through taxation. The corporate itself does not pay federal income tax. Instead, profits flow directly to the members’ personal tax returns. This removes the possibility of double taxation and infrequently results in a lighter administrative load. Utah LLCs can even elect to be taxed as an S corporation, a selection that may reduce self-employment taxes for sure businesses.
Liability protection is another critical advantage. A Utah LLC shields members’ personal assets from most enterprise money owed and legal claims. This protection holds as long because the LLC follows basic formalities akin to keeping finances separate and maintaining an working agreement. The working agreement itself is a strong tool. It outlines roles, ownership percentages, buyout guidelines, and dispute resolution, all without the inflexibleity required of corporations.
For many early-stage founders, the ease of upkeep is appealing. Utah LLCs have fewer annual requirements, straightforward recordkeeping, and less pressure to hold formal meetings. This frees founders to focus on progress instead of compliance tasks.
Utah Corporation: Structured, Scalable, and Investment-Ready
A Utah company follows a more formal structure, which usually benefits high-growth startups, especially those planning to lift substantial outside capital. Corporations have shareholders, directors, and officers, each with defined responsibilities. While this might really feel more rigid, investors usually prefer this structure because it creates a predictable governance framework.
The ability to challenge stock makes corporations attractive to angel investors, venture capital firms, and employees who count on equity-primarily based compensation. Companies are built for scalability. If you intend to raise multiple rounds of funding or go public sometime, the corporate structure often aligns better with these goals.
Taxation differs significantly. A traditional C corporation pays corporate revenue tax on profits, and shareholders pay taxes on dividends they receive. This is known as double taxation. Even with that drawback, C firms supply advantages such as the ability to retain earnings within the business and potential eligibility for the federal Certified Small Business Stock (QSBS) exclusion, which can reduce or eliminate capital features taxes on stock sales.
A corporation requires ongoing compliance. Utah companies must hold annual shareholder meetings, maintain detailed records, file annual reports, and comply with strict formalities. These requirements support transparency and investor confidence however create more administrative work.
Find out how to Choose the Best Fit for Your Utah Startup
If your priority is flexibility, easy taxation, minimal paperwork, and straightforward management, a Utah LLC generally meets these needs. It enables you to operate lean, keep control, and reduce administrative overhead.
If your startup is built for fast scale, seeks funding from investors, plans for complex equity structures, or aims for a future public providing, forming a Utah corporation usually provides a greater foundation.
Your alternative ought to match your business model, growth plans, and long-term vision. Taking time to compare both buildings helps guarantee your startup begins on stable, strategic ground.
